Concepcion Zambrano Vasquez, 85, passed away on January 27, 2009. Our beloved mother was a woman of strong faith and gentle kindness. She was born on June 26, 1923 in Fabens, Texas and remained a life long resident. She worked as a clerk at the Five and Dime and retired after 17 years. Affectionately known as Nina Concha to her family, she was a loving wife, mother, grandmother and aunt. She is survived by: her sons Manuel David, his wife Martha, David Jr.; her daughters Vida Vasquez Taylor, Norma Rey Vazquez de Houdek, her wife Mary Houdek; and four grandchildren Teresa Irene, Carina Beth, Sarah Grace, her husband Guillermo Armendariz , and Justin David. She was preceded in death by her husband David. A special thanks to Regent Care Center for their kindness towards our mother and family.
